Chandrayaan-3, India’s latest Moon mission, has entered the lunar orbit, the country’s space agency has said. The spacecraft with an orbiter...
South Pole
Chandrayaan-3, India’s latest Moon mission, has entered the lunar orbit, the country’s space agency has said. The spacecraft with an orbiter...